About Burnettsville, IN

Burnettsville is a small community in Indiana with a population of 352 residents. The median household income is $68,500 per year, which is near the national average. The median age in Burnettsville is 38.3 years.

Housing in Burnettsville has a median home value of $103,500 and median monthly rent of $833. Of the 155 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 123 owner-occupied and 21 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Burnettsville is 0.6% and the poverty rate is 6.3%. 9.5%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 19.7 minutes.

Cost of Living in Burnettsville, IN

Compared to national averages, Burnettsville has a median household income of $68,500 (9%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$103,500, which is 58% below the national median. Monthly rent at $833 is 28% below the US average of $1,163. Within Indiana, Burnettsville's income is 1% below the state average of $69,330, and home values are 37% below the state median of $163,409.
